Police warn of new lottery scam
CLINTON - Clinton police authorities are warning of a new mail scam in which a cashier's check is sent as a down payment to even more lottery winnings. Once the check is put in the bank, a notice is sent asking for money from the recipient for insurance and to cover any kind of processing expense so that the additional winnings can be sent.
